Common MCM Roof Types and Their Maintenance Needs

\n\n

Mid-Century Modern homes in Northcrest typically feature one of three roof types, each requiring different care approaches. Understanding your specific roof type helps you develop an effective maintenance strategy.

\n\n

Flat roofs dominate many MCM neighborhoods, offering clean lines that complement the architectural style. These roofs often use built-up roofing (BUR) with gravel surfacing or modern membrane systems like TPO or EPDM. The gravel layer, while providing UV protection, can trap debris and make leak detection difficult. Membrane roofs offer easier maintenance but require careful seam inspection.

\n\n

Shed roofs, characterized by a single sloping plane, were popular in later MCM designs. These roofs drain in one direction and often feature large overhangs that provide shade but can also trap leaves and pine needles. The exposed rafters typical of MCM design require special attention to prevent wood rot in Atlanta’s humid environment.

\n\n

Butterfly roofs create dramatic architectural statements but present unique drainage challenges. Water flows toward the center rather than the edges, requiring internal drainage systems that can clog easily. The low points where roof planes meet become critical failure points during heavy rainfall events common to the Piedmont region.

Material Spotlight: Best Options for MCM Roof Replacements

\n\n

When replacement becomes necessary, choosing materials that maintain your home’s MCM aesthetic while providing modern performance is crucial. Several options balance these requirements while addressing Atlanta’s specific challenges.

\n\n

TPO (Thermoplastic Polyolefin) has become increasingly popular for MCM homes due to its clean appearance and energy efficiency. The white reflective surface combats Atlanta’s urban heat island effect, potentially reducing cooling costs by 15-20%. Modern TPO membranes offer 25-30 year lifespans when properly maintained and include enhanced UV resistance specifically designed for Southern climates.

\n\n

EPDM (Ethylene Propylene Diene Monomer) provides another excellent option, particularly for homes seeking a low-profile appearance. The black membrane absorbs heat in winter while reflecting UV in summer when coated with reflective paint. EPDM’s flexibility makes it ideal for handling Atlanta’s thermal expansion without seam failure.

\n\n

Modified bitumen offers the look of traditional built-up roofing with modern performance. The torch-down installation creates seamless protection ideal for Atlanta’s heavy rainfall. The granulated surface provides excellent traction for maintenance access while offering superior impact resistance from falling tree limbs common in Northcrest’s mature neighborhoods.

\n\n

Consider adding tapered insulation systems during replacement to improve drainage. These systems create a slight slope (typically 1/4 inch per foot) that moves water toward drains without altering your home’s visual profile. The added insulation also improves energy efficiency, crucial for Atlanta’s hot summers.

Identifying Leaks in Post-and-Beam Construction

\n\n

MCM homes in Northcrest present unique leak detection challenges due to their post-and-beam construction. Unlike traditional framed homes, water can travel along beams for considerable distances before appearing as interior damage. Understanding these patterns helps you identify problems early.

\n\n

Start with interior inspections during rainfall. Water stains on ceilings often appear away from the actual leak source. Trace stains back toward exterior walls, but understand the water may have traveled horizontally along a beam before dripping. Pay special attention to areas around skylights, chimneys, and HVAC penetrations.

\n\n

Exterior inspections should focus on penetration points where utilities enter the roof. These areas commonly fail due to movement and weathering. Check for cracked or separated sealant around vents, pipes, and exhaust fans. The Georgia climate accelerates sealant deterioration, requiring more frequent replacement than manufacturers typically recommend.

\n\n

Moisture meters provide the most reliable leak detection method. Professional inspectors use these tools to measure moisture content in roof decking and insulation. Readings above 20% indicate active water intrusion requiring immediate attention. This diagnostic approach prevents the “chase the stain” problem common in post-and-beam construction.

\n\n

Thermal imaging offers another diagnostic tool for leak detection. During temperature differentials (early morning or evening), moisture appears as temperature anomalies on thermal cameras. This technology can identify wet areas before visible damage appears, allowing for targeted repairs rather than complete roof replacement.

Moss and Algae Treatment for Humid Climates

\n\n

Atlanta’s high humidity creates ideal conditions for moss and algae growth on roofing materials. These organisms not only detract from your home’s appearance but also retain moisture against the roof surface, accelerating deterioration. Understanding prevention and treatment is essential for MCM homeowners.

\n\n

Algae typically appears as dark streaks on roofing materials, particularly on north-facing slopes that receive less direct sunlight. While primarily cosmetic, algae retains moisture and can promote the growth of more damaging organisms. Copper or zinc strips installed at roof ridges can prevent algae growth through natural oxidation.

\n\n

Moss presents a more serious threat, particularly in shaded areas under tree canopy common in Northcrest. Moss roots penetrate roofing materials, creating entry points for water. During Atlanta’s freeze-thaw cycles, moss expansion can lift and separate roofing materials. Physical removal combined with chemical treatment provides the most effective control.

\n\n

Prevention focuses on reducing moisture retention. Trim tree branches that create excessive shade or drop debris onto the roof. Ensure proper drainage to prevent standing water where organisms thrive. Consider algae-resistant shingles or coatings when replacement becomes necessary.

\n\n

Treatment requires careful product selection. Harsh chemicals can damage roofing materials and surrounding landscaping. Oxygen-based cleaners provide effective control without the environmental impact of chlorine-based products. Always follow manufacturer recommendations and consider professional application for steep or difficult-to-access roofs.
